Taxes Due in Durham

The last day to pay tax bills without penalty is February 1. This date is required per state statutes and I do not have a legal authority to change the last day to pay.

If the Town Hall is closed early or not open at all due to safety concerns related to weather the February 1 date is still the last day to pay without penalty.

Please note that we accept mail with a USPS postmark of February 1 as on-time. If you have not sent your payment you can still go to the Post Office on Tuesday and mail an "on-time" payment.

The Town website: www.townofdurhamct.org also allows for electronic payments. Be advised that there is a fee associated with this service.

Martin French, CCMC

Tax Collector
